Giovanni AugustoΒ Here's a screenshot from inside a FluentForm with an embedded booking form. When I click on the booking element inside the form I get the settings screen you see on the right side. I've highlighted the setting that I think you're looking for. When I uncheck "show host info" then I only get the calendar - no other info.
